Marygrove College was a private Catholic liberal arts college located in Detroit, Michigan, founded by the Sisters, Servants of the Immaculate Heart of Mary (IHM) in 1905 in Monroe, Michigan, and relocated to Detroit in 1927. For over 90 years in Detroit, it was dedicated to providing a strong liberal arts education with a focus on social justice, community service, and leadership development, serving a diverse student body, including many first-generation college students. The college offered undergraduate and graduate programs in areas like education, social work, visual and performing arts, and business. Due to declining enrollment and financial challenges, Marygrove College ceased its undergraduate programs in 2017 and fully closed all operations in December 2019. Its historic campus is now being redeveloped by the Marygrove Conservancy.
Historically, this was the sole campus of Marygrove College, housing all academic programs, administrative offices, library, residential halls, and student life facilities. It served as the heart of the college community.
The campus is known for its English Gothic architectural style, particularly the Liberal Arts Building (1929), Madame Cadillac Hall (1927), and the Scholastica Library. The campus also featured a performing arts center and expansive green spaces.
Historically, Marygrove fostered a close-knit, mission-driven environment characterized by a strong commitment to liberal arts education, social justice, personalized student attention, and community engagement, influenced by its IHM Sisters sponsorship.
For nearly a century, Marygrove College's campus was a vital educational and cultural landmark in Detroit, particularly significant for providing higher education opportunities to women, minority students, and first-generation college attendees. It was a beacon of learning and community service.

The Kresge Foundation • September 1, 2022
The Marygrove Conservancy announced the completion of the first phase of its landmark cradle-to-career (P-20) campus including a new early childhood education center, and the K-12 The School at Marygrove, operated by Detroit Public Schools Community District, on the former Marygrove College grounds....more
Detroit Free Press • December 18, 2019
After 92 years in Detroit, Marygrove College held its final academic day, marking the official closure of the small, private liberal arts college that struggled with declining enrollment and financial issues. The closure impacted its remaining graduate students and faculty....more
